When XRootD is run in a docker container, and xrdfs ls
from another machine different than the docker host, it times out.
The cause seems to be that xrootd send the location of the directory as an ip address not as a hostname
[2020-06-24 16:14:12.217271 +0200][Dump ][XRootD ] [cc-escape-xcache-docker-test.in2p3.fr:1094] Parsing the response to kXR_locate (path: */, flags: kXR_prefname ) as LocateInfo: Sw[::172.18.0.2]:1094
[2020-06-24 16:14:12.217330 +0200][Dump ][FileSystem ] [0x17ea760@DeepLocate(*/)] Got 1 locations
[2020-06-24 16:14:12.217488 +0200][Dump ][Utility ] URL: [::172.18.0.2]:1094
Here is a repo to test
https://github.com/pmusset/dockerized-xrootd-ls-error
Already talked about with @simonmichal
—
You are receiving this because you are subscribed to this thread.
Reply to this email directly, view it on GitHub, or unsubscribe.
Use REPLY-ALL to reply to list
To unsubscribe from the XROOTD-DEV list, click the following link:
https://listserv.slac.stanford.edu/cgi-bin/wa?SUBED1=XROOTD-DEV&A=1